| Stage | What happens | Code |
| --- | --- | --- |
| **Observe** | Gemini Vision turns each screen frame into structured work context (file, symbol, activity, unpushed hints) | `backend/src/vision/gemini.ts` |
| **Detect** | Same file touched by 2+ engineers with unpushed work → a coordination event | `backend/src/collision/detector.ts` |
| **Recall (memory)** | Embed the event, query MongoDB Atlas `$vectorSearch` for similar past events, attach their prior intervention + outcome | `backend/src/memory/vectors.ts` |
| **Policy gate (adapt)** | A dismissed false alarm stays silent; a confirmed real catch escalates to critical; a per-pod cooldown prevents nagging | `backend/src/memory/policy.ts` |
| **Act (least intrusive)** | Reuse the action kind that was accepted before; default to a card, escalate to a Hermes message, voice only when urgent | `backend/src/action/hermes.ts` |
| **Record (feedback)** | Accept/dismiss + "was it real?" is written back to memory, closing the loop for next time | `backend/src/memory/store.ts` |

A few things make this real learning rather than a static prompt:
- It adapts from real teammate behavior during a real session, not an offline
